Capacity note for Beaconbot, the deploy-status chat bot. Peak load tracks release windows: expect bursts when a train cuts. Support impact: if the bot throttles, status queries queue rather than fail, so expect lag, not silence. We sized the worker pool for two concurrent release trains plus incident chatter. Scaling past that needs a new shard. Current limits are set as follows.

limits module of tafop-hahop:
WEIGHTS = {
    "julmir": 223,
    "belox": 987,
    "lamion": 470,
    "pelath": 609,
    "fraok": 1010,
    "eliion": 343,
    "drudor": 342,
}

# Artifact Signing — Renderhusk Transcode Farm

Quick notes for the weekly sync: every transcoder build coming out of the Renderhusk pipeline gets signed before it hits the farm nodes. No signature, no deploy — the node agent hard-fails. We rotated everything last sprint after the packaging rework, so old docs are stale. Verification takes about two seconds per artifact. The key currently in use is pasted below.

deploy key for yajop-fahop: bky3_h1v

FAQ: What happens during a fire-drill roll call?

When the alarm sounds at Copperfield Yard, all visiting contractors must assemble at the north courtyard marker and answer the roll call taken by the floor warden. Do not re-enter until cleared. To return through the side entrance after the drill, use the re-entry code below.

door code, yagap-bahof: bdg-O-05

## Environments: Tenant Quotas

The Spindrift API enforces per-tenant rate quotas separately in each environment. Staging quotas are deliberately loose so partners can load-test; production quotas are strict and changes require a ticket. If a tenant reports throttling, check which environment they hit before adjusting anything — most false alarms come from staging credentials used against production. The current production quota configuration, which on-call may need to compare against, is reproduced below.

settings of tagef-bawif:
DRUIX_HOST=druix.zemvarlabs.internal
DRUIX_PORT=8000